Audit item 14: Verify that the Meadowfern clinic appointment reminder job ran within its scheduled window for the past 30 days, that failed sends were retried per policy, and that opt-out flags were honored. Attach the run log summary to the release record before sign-off. Confirmation of this item must be obtained from the accountable owner named below:

signatory, kafop-bahaf: Lamion Queniel Jorir Olidor

Checklist item 7 — Guest Wi-Fi desk setup

Before the new starter arrives at Larkspun House, confirm the guest Wi-Fi desk at reception is staffed and the laminated instruction card is displayed. Facilities desk: verify the sign-in tablet is charged and the day's voucher sheet is stocked. The desk cupboard must remain locked between shifts; it opens with the code below.

turnstile pass: bdg-QZV-3

## Deploying the Gatewick Proctor Queue

Deploys are pretty painless: push to main, wait for the pipeline, then watch the queue drain dashboard for five minutes. If candidates pile up mid-exam, roll back first and ask questions later — the queue replays safely. Everything the workers care about lives in one config block, shown here for reference.

settings of bafof-yagef:
JOROX_PIN=8740
JOROX_TENANT=pelox
JOROX_METRICS_HOST=metrics.jorox.qorvelworks.internal
JOROX_SEAL=seal_c78f63c1
JOROX_STANDBY_TEAM=norax

The extract-strings script walks the Wrenfold app's source tree, pulls every call to the translate helper, and emits a deduplicated catalog keyed by namespace. Plurals and interpolation markers are validated at extraction time; malformed entries fail the build. Runtime behavior is driven by a few tunables that rarely change, which we keep in one place, shown here.

tuning table, yajog-yahof:
BUDGETS = {
    "lamvan": 303,
    "wenox": 460,
    "fenvan": 525,
}